Word: Dubious

Part of Speech: Adjective

Meaning: Doubtful or uncertain; not sure if something is true or good.

Synonyms: Doubtful, suspicious, uncertain

Antonyms: Certain, confident, sure

Usage Examples

Example 1: She looked dubious when she heard the unlikely story about Bigfoot.

Example 2: The teacher had a dubious expression when the student claimed his dog ate his homework.

Example 3: Some people were dubious about the effectiveness of the new medicine until they saw the results.

Fun Fact

The word "dubious" comes from the Latin word "dubiosus," which means "doubtful." It has been used in the English language since the late 16th century, often to express skepticism towards a statement or idea.
